WebFeb 7, 2024 · Multiple bones may become involved. Areas commonly affected by GSD include the ribs, spine, pelvis, skull, collarbone (clavicle), and jaw. Pain and swelling in the affected area may occur. Bones affected by GSD are prone to reduced bone mass (osteopenia) and fracture. Radiographic features. The imaging appearance of generalised lymphatic anomaly recapitulates the typical features of lymphatic malformation, namely multiseptated cystic mass lesions which tend to insinuate and invade adjacent normal structures.
